Cosmetic Dentistry Options For Repairing Jagged Teeth

Having a jagged or crooked tooth can cause you to be self-conscious about your smile, but there are a few cosmetic dentistry options you can choose to restore your smile. Here are just a few choices you have when it comes to repairing a crooked or jagged tooth.

Dental Bonding

Dental bonding can restore the shape of your tooth through the use of tooth-colored resin. The resin is bonded to your tooth and shaped to create a natural look for your teeth. Bonding is an excellent option if your tooth needs minor repairs to shape the tooth properly. Bonding can also be used in conjunction with other cosmetic dental procedures to improve your overall smile.

Veneers

Dental veneers are ultra-thin shells that are placed over your teeth to create the new shape. They are often made of porcelain, though they do come in other tooth-colored materials as well. They can be a great option if your tooth is severely misshapen or if you have several teeth that need cosmetic dental work. Dental veneers can also be used if you have severely discolored teeth to bring a bright white back to your smile.

Dental Contouring

Dental contouring is a process used to change the shape of your tooth. If you have a crooked tooth, your dentist may smooth out the edges with dental contouring. He or she will use a sanding instrument to reduce the appearance of the crooked or jagged edge. In some cases, dentists will use contouring with bonding to reshape the original tooth and add extra material to create a more finished appearance.

Crowns

Crowns are similar to veneers in that they cover your original tooth material. They are essentially caps that fit over your tooth to create a natural look. They can be used to hide imperfections in the tooth, and they can also be used if you have a cavity. Crowns are a bit sturdier than veneers, and they may be used to help when the crack or jagged edge impacts the functionality of your tooth.
